About Londonderry El Sch

Set in Middletown, Pennsylvania, Londonderry El Sch is a small primary school, one of the schools within Lower Dauphin SD. It serves 234 students across grades K through 5. Enrollment runs roughly 47% smaller than the state mean of about 443.

Lower Dauphin SD comprises 8 schools with combined enrollment of 3,339 students; Londonderry El Sch is among them.

In terms of who attends, Londonderry El Sch records that the largest single group is White, at 80% of enrollment; the rest comes out to 9% Hispanic, 8% multiracial, 3% Black. The wider county runs roughly 63% White, putting the school's mix considerably more White than the area baseline.

In terms of school funding signals, On paper, Londonderry El Sch has 22 full-time-equivalent teachers, translating to a class-load average of around 10.6:1. That figure is tighter than the state norm's 13.1:1 average. An estimated 48% of students are eligible for free or reduced-price lunch, a number frequently used as a low-income enrollment indicator. That share is below Dauphin County's rate of about 59%.

On a demographically-adjusted basis, Londonderry El Sch performs roughly as the BeatsExpectations model predicts for a school with this FRL share. The predicted value is around 56.9%, the actual is 51.5%, a residual of -5.4 points.

Across the wider county, community-level numbers for Dauphin County indicate median household income runs about $76,242, roughly 34% of adults have completed at least a four-year degree, and the poverty rate sits near 9%. Across Dauphin County's 75 public schools (combined enrollment of about 72,718 students), Londonderry El Sch is one campus in the mix.

The closest other public school is Fink El Sch, roughly 2.5 miles away. 7 of the 8 nearest public schools sit inside a five-mile radius. Among the 9 schools in that immediate cluster with test data (this one included), Londonderry El Sch ranks 5th on composite proficiency, below the local average of 54.0%.

Geographically, the school is in a rural area.

Trend over the last 7 years. Over the past 7-year window, the student count fell 18%: 284 students in 2018 compared to 234 in 2025. The White share of enrollment shrank from 87% to 80% over that span.
